Ana Fernández moves to Granadilla

Ana Fernández moves to Granadilla Tenerife from Madrid CFF.
The 22-year-old went through the academy ranks of Atlético Madrid, but joined the city rivals after failing to make a breakthrough to the first team. For Madrid CFF, the Spanish centre back played mostly in the B team, but already debuted in Liga Iberdrola as well. “I am very happy and grateful to the club, eager to start working with the group and enjoy this new stage. It is a new experience to those I have had before, so I come with the intention of contributing my bit and above all a lot of work,” added Fernández.
